Infortrend Powers Enterprise Storage With JB 4000U NVMe Unit
Infortrend Technology just released their first NVMe flash expansion box called JB 4000U. They make storage systems for businesses, and this new product helps companies that need fast data access with lots of space. People working with artificial intelligence, media companies, and anyone doing large backups will love how quickly they can grab their files. This expansion box works perfectly with their existing EonStor GS storage systems that use U.2 NVMe technology. The JB 4000U fits into just 2 rack units yet holds 24 NVMe flash drives. When you connect both controllers, data moves through at 24 gigabytes per second—about half again faster than their best SAS drive boxes. Axiomtek MMB566 Boosts Industrial Computing With Fast IO
Axiomtek makes computer parts for businesses. They just released a new motherboard called the MMB566. This board works great for tough jobs in factories and stores. It runs on different Intel chips, such as Core i9, i7, i5, i3, or Celeron from the 14th, 13th, or 12th generation. The board uses Intel Q670E, R680E, or H610E chipsets to handle everything. The MMB566 helps machines run smoothly when they need exact control. Companies use it to check equipment from far away and run tests automatically. It crunches numbers fast to analyze large amounts of information. The board stands up to hard work day after day in banking machines where people need money at all hours. DATA Technology Announces Ultracompact Dual Port SSD
DATA Technology Co. Ltd. has created something new for people who need memory storage. They just released the SC730 external SSD, which weighs only 7.8 grams and comes with both USB-C and USB-A plugs. No other drive this small offers both connection types. You can transfer files really fast at speeds up to 600 MB/s, perfect for anyone who travels a lot. The company built the outside case using 50% recycled materials, showing its commitment to environmental programs through ESG initiatives. This tiny drive packs amazing features into its small body.
